Chardonnay
2008 Reserve Chardonnay - Carneros [ $32 ] BUY THIS WINE
 

The grapes for our 2008 Reserve Chardonnay come primarily from Ferrari-Carano’s vineyard in the Napa Valley Carneros appellation. Comprised of three Chardonnay clones, this wine has lush hazelnut, spice, butterscotch and Fuji apple aromas with delicious caramel, pear, fig, crème brule, and toasty oak flavors with a creamy, buttery finish. The cool climate of Napa Valley Carneros imparts its unique delicacy and finesse to the wine, while the Alexander Valley component adds an intensely rich mouth-filling character.

Vintage Notes
A year of fire and ice, we began 2008 battling heavy frost in April, and heat in the summer and early fall. Reduced yields but intensely flavored, well-balanced, ripe fruit was the happy result of a very challenging growing season. The grapes for this wine were harvested mid-September — 2008 was one of the fastest harvests we can remember.

Winemakers Notes
Each individual lot for this wine is whole cluster pressed and then cold settled for two days in stainless steel tanks before moving to barrels for fermentation. The wine completes 95 percent malolactic fermentation and is sur lie aged in French oak barrels and stirred every two weeks for nine months until blending in June. Then the blended wine is aged an additional six months in neutral French oak until bottling.

Appellation: 92% Napa Valley Carneros, 8% Alexander Valley
Blend: 100% Chardonnay
Cooperage: 49% new French oak, 51% older French oak
Release Day: August 2010
